The Fee Structure Policy is in place to ensure timeliness, punctuality, and regularity of attendance against the value and importance of the therapist’s time and effort in providing therapy and being present and available for sessions with the client.
Following is the fee structure policy formulated to protect the financial rights of both the client and therapist:
Admission Fee
To secure your slot with an assigned therapist and ensure timely access to our services, an admission fee is required before scheduling your first session. This fee is applicable to clients on both monthly and weekly/per-session payment plans. Due to the high demand and limited availability of our therapists, this fee helps us manage our client waiting list efficiently. Additionally, the admission fee represents your formal entry into our organization, granting you access to our comprehensive range of services.
Monthly Payments
1. Clients that are on a monthly payment plan will pay the full month’s amount before the start of the month’s first scheduled session.

Every one session in that the client is a no show or last-minute cancellation, a follow up session will be required with the Manager of Operations and Finance at CIC (for which the Manager will contact said clients directly) to discuss why this delay is taking place and how it can be resolved before further sessions can be conducted.
3. Upon failure to attend two sessions (via no show or last-minute cancellation) the slot will be released with the therapist and admission fee will have to be paid again in order to continue sessions with the therapist.
Per-Session/Weekly Payments
1. Clients that are on a weekly payment plan will pay one full session’s amount before the start of the first scheduled session with their therapist.
2. Before the second session, the client will pay the full amount of their per-session charges for the second and third therapy sessions in advance.
3. Before the third session, the client will pay the full amount of their per-session charges for the fourth therapy session in advance. This structure will follow similarly for all subsequent sessions.

Every one session in that the client fails to attend a scheduled session (via no show or last minute cancellation), a follow up session will be required with the Manager of Finance at CIC (for which the Manager will contact said clients directly) to discuss why this delay is taking place and how it can be resolved before further sessions can be conducted.
5. Upon failure to attend two sessions (via no show or last-minute cancellation) the slot will be released with the therapist and admission fee will have to be paid again in order to continue sessions with the therapist.
Additional Information
Kindly note that wherever ‘no show’ and ‘last-minute cancellation’ is written only refers to sessions which were:
- pre-scheduled
- clients received a reminder 24 hours in advance
- clients received their session link 24 hours in advance
- yet the clients failed to show up at the appointed time.
‘No show’ or ‘last minute cancellation’ does not refer to sessions which were cancelled by the client at least 24 hours prior to the scheduled session due to ‘valid emergencies’ which include but are not limited to:
- major health issues/hospitalization of the client or someone in the nuclear family structure whom the client has to take care of as well as other reasons (in this context) due to which the clients functionality to attend sessions is affected
- death within immediate or extended family which the client
has to take part in or due to which clients functionality to attend sessions is affected - financial issues due to which ability to pay for a sessions is compromised.
For Valid Emergencies: Parents/Clients/Guardians will have to reschedule such sessions to a later time within the same week (if possible) or any following week after to ensure therapeutic continuity and progress is not lost.
Other invalid emergencies such as:
- birthday parties
- exams
- sports events
- short (week-long) family vacations, or
- other appointments
must be informed of at least a week in advance in order to not count as a ‘no show’.
Lengthy (month-long) family vacations must be informed of at least a month in advance to not count as a ‘no show’.
Clients discontinuing sessions/ceasing attendance during the therapeutic process without notice prior to the closure date, will be subject to the Re-Admission procedure. This includes:
- refilling the Client Data Sheet
- having a fresh consultation session with the Chief Care Officer
- paying the admission fees as per the Monthly Payment/Per-Session Payment structure.
This action will apply if Client does not return to continue sessions within a 3-month grace period.
